              This is an easy fix for the mobile. Go to the search icon (bottom right) in the app. In the search area, type settings. It will bring up the settings for this app. At the bottom, you'll see temperature with a C next to it. Simply touch the C and it will change to F. I've closed the app and reopened it several times and it does not change back to C. Fixed.
